Position Overview


AKIVA is seeking a Program Analyst to execute data-related project tasks under the direction of the Program Manager at the VA Long Beach Healthcare System. The Program Analyst provides leadership and management of basic projects, ensures quality performance by the project team, and works with spreadsheet and relational databases to organize data. The role delivers graphic design support including organizational charts, training materials, and visual aids, and communicates highly technical information to senior management, the user community, and less experienced staff. AKIVA-provided AI-assisted data analysis and visualization tools will be leveraged to accelerate trend identification, chart production, and strategic reporting.



Key Responsibilities


• Attend weekly Space Management Team (SMT) meetings and participate in working groups with Hospital Services


• Conduct database research of VA databases for information on patient projections; collaborate with VALB Informatics


• Provide data analytics support — analyze data, identify trends, and build supporting products


• Translate space requirements into project plans: turn space and facility requirements into a list of projects to complete over the next 15 years


• Provide support to Space Management site surveys covering function, purpose, and ownership of spaces across the VALB campus


• Assist the Space Management Team in planning and executing space moves driven by renovations, construction, or user requests


• Develop deliverables, organizational charts, training materials, and other visual aids for varying audiences


• Examine large data sets to identify trends, develop charts, and create visual presentations that help VALB leadership make strategic decisions


• Review assessments and recommendations in accordance with federal regulations and standards and verify compliance


• Leverage AKIVA AI-assisted tools for accelerated data analysis, reporting, and visualization workflows



Required Qualifications


• Bachelor's degree with 2+ years of experience in data analytics and a minimum of 1 year of project management experience


• Knowledge of data mining and data warehouse processes, data modeling, R or SAS, SQL, statistical analysis, database management, and reporting


• Knowledge of computer-aided design programs such as AutoCAD, Bluebeam, or equivalent


• Experience using Geographic Information Systems (GIS) such as ArcGIS


• Proficiency with the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, Word, PowerPoint, Outlook)


• Strong written and verbal communication skills for technical and executive audiences


• Must be authorized to work in the United States
